The JAC S3 is a budget compact SUV, the cheapest way into the brand's UAE lineup and a straightforward alternative to the mainstream Japanese and Korean crossovers at this price. It carries more used history here than most of JAC's newer models, but the dealer's warranty and parts support still matter more than they would with an established name.

How long does a JAC S3 last?
Cars we inspect sit at a median of 44,000 km, a solid amount of everyday driving rather than the near-zero mileage typical of newer Chinese-brand listings. That is a reasonable sign, but confirm the warranty transfer and how easily JAC's UAE dealers can source parts before you judge the car on mileage alone.
